Set clang as default compiler
WebBuild Clang: Open LLVM.sln in Visual Studio. Build the "clang" project for just the compiler driver and front end, or the "ALL_BUILD" project to build everything, including tools. Try it … WebContents. clang-tidy is a clang-based C++ “linter” tool. Its purpose is to provide an extensible framework for diagnosing and fixing typical programming errors, like style violations, interface misuse, or bugs that can be deduced via static analysis. clang-tidy is modular and provides a convenient interface for writing new checks.
Set clang as default compiler
Did you know?
WebMay 21, 2024 · llvm-hs builds OK with clang, but not gcc (not for any low-level reason, but because it thinks it is compiling C when compiling C++ in places, for example). It is, of course, easy enough to set these by hand but it would seem more robust either to ask the user which compiler should be used or, ideally, to follow homebrew and default to clang. WebSep 20, 2012 · CMake will set them during toolchain discovery and messing around with them may cause every type of havoc if you are unlucky. export CC=clang export CXX=clang++ Eike Previous message: [CMake] A way to set default compiler, etc.? Next message: [CMake] A way to set default compiler, etc.?
WebSep 15, 2014 · clang compiles way faster, and has been written from the very start to be modular and in C++ (gcc started using a small C++ subset recently, because it was a total mess). It's first a set of libraries that things like IDE and YouCompleteMe can use, and then a standalone compiler. WebJun 18, 2024 · You told the system that in order to use cc it should use the clang40 executable. However, these are make settings (it's all in the name really: make.conf) so obviously they will not affect your OS itself but only sessions which utilize make. If you want to use Clang 4.0 then use that executable. Don't start cc but clang40 instead.
WebJul 17, 2024 · It can be done on the command line by setting compiler: python setup.py build_ext -c python setup.py build_ext --help-compiler to see available … WebJun 12, 2024 · The way to change the default setting when used "standalone" (i.e. without an Xcode project, Makefile or similar) is actually to make a shell alias. There's no clang …
WebFeb 22, 2024 · Our current code only supports Clang. To do that, we pass -DCMAKE_CXX_COMPILER=clang++ to CMake. However, when I use vcpkg install it goes back to system default compiler (g++ on some of the build agents.) Is there an option to set default compiler for vcpkg steps to clang++. I can, of course, export compiler from …
WebSep 18, 2024 · Step 1: Install prerequisites sudo apt-get install build-essential xz-utils curl Step 2: Download the necessary binaries and extract them. curl -SL … ethan allen old tavern collectionWebFeb 20, 2024 · To install clang++ on Linux, you will need to download the clang++ compiler from the LLVM website. Once you have downloaded the compiler, you will need to follow the instructions on the website to install it. Install Clang Mac To install clang on a mac, you can use a package manager like Homebrew or MacPorts. firefly kitchen and bars traverse city miWebTo change the default C compiler, at the MATLAB command prompt, type: mex -setup mex -setup defaults to information about the C compiler. MATLAB also displays links to other … firefly kitchen kimchiClang can be set as an alternative for /usr/bin/cc. This is the standard way of setting a C compiler, and it should be reasonably safe. (Even so, I wouldn't be surprised if some build processes break due to an assumption that /usr/bin/cc on a Linux system is always GCC.) Share Improve this answer Follow answered Apr 22, 2024 at 19:40 user149341 2 firefly kitchen bar alpharettaethan allen old tavern furnitureWebDec 6, 2024 · With CMake 3.15 it has become possible to use the Clang compiler on Windows with a GNU-style command line. This also means that it’s possible to use … firefly king\u0027s ely seniorWebClang is a front-end to LLVM that supports C and the GNU C extensions required by the kernel, and is pronounced “klang,” not “see-lang.” Clang¶ The compiler used can be swapped out via CC= command line argument to make. CC= should be set when selecting a config and during a build. firefly kitchen and bar